Calculating standard deviation by hand can be time-consuming but can also help you understand the concept better. Start by calculating the mean, then find the squared differences from the mean, sum them up, and divide by the number of data points.

Standard deviation is a measure of the amount of variation or dispersion in a set of values. The formula calculates the square root of the mean of the squared differences from the mean. In simple terms, it measures how spread out the data points are from the mean value. The formula is as follows:
σ = √((Σ(x - μ)²) / n)
